In a classic example of WHAT WENT WRONG THE LAST 8 YEARS, Tom Ridge is only NOW brave enough to say that he believes the United States was unjust to go against International Law.

Speaking on the BBC’s ‘World Today” program, the former Pennsylvania governor and first federal homeland security chief said he accepts some of the criticisms levied in a recent report International Commission of Jurists.

“regardless of what terror suspects are accused of doing, they deserve “some sense of due process.”

Bravery and courage require SPEAKING OUT when your morals and values are violated.  Ridge did neither.  Sure, its great that he mea culpas now, but what about the hundreds of thousands of moments of torture that happened under his watch, because he did not speak out?

Ridge has a history of abdicating his conscience and blindly following George Bush’s leadership. According to USA Today,

The Bush administration periodically put the USA on high alert for terrorist attacks even though then-Homeland Security chief Tom Ridge argued there was only flimsy evidence to justify raising the threat level, Ridge now says.

Ridge … said … that he often disagreed with administration officials who wanted to elevate the threat level to orange, or “high” risk of terrorist attack, but was overruled.
